
Reykjavík
Creative Capital
The world's northernmost capital punches far above its weight—a colorful city of creative energy, volcanic drama, and the freshest seafood on earth. Gateway to Iceland's wilderness, Reykjavík rewards those who explore its quirky neighborhoods.
June to August for midnight sun, September to March for Northern Lights
2-3 nights recommended
City Explorers, Foodies, Design Lovers, Northern Lights Seekers
